Classification of railway berths as seats confirms exemption eligibility under Notification No.61/86 when steel and tariff conditions met. Goods classifiable as seats qualify for exemption where they are made partly or wholly of steel, designed for use in automobiles, railway carriages or aircraft, and fall within the relevant seating tariff headings; bottom berths are seats and middle and top berths are akin to them, so berths made partly or wholly of steel for railway carriages qualify as steel seats for exemption under the notification when those conditions are satisfied.
